KATE<br />

SPADE<br />

by Jennifer Costanzo | fashion columnist<br />

B<br />

orn Katherine Noel Brosnahan on<br />

December 24, 1962 in Kansas City,<br />

Missouri. Kate attended the University<br />

of Kansas, then transferred and<br />

graduated from Arizona State University, with<br />

a degree in journalism. Spade met her future<br />

husband, Andy Spade, in Arizona where they<br />

worked together at a men’s clothing boutique.<br />

Kate Spade was interested in writing and followed<br />

her dreams of journalism when she moved<br />

to Manhattan to work for a fashion magazine<br />

called Mademoiselle in 1986. Spade worked<br />

her way up in the magazine, finally becoming<br />

senior fashion editor and head of accessories<br />

at Mademoiselle. It was at the magazine where<br />

Spade realized her calling, into accessory design.<br />

Spade left the magazine in 1991 to pursue her<br />

dream to create her own handbag, due to the<br />

lack of stylish and sensible handbags at the time.<br />

Working with accessories at Mademoiselle, gave<br />

Spade an extra edge through her knowledge and<br />

interest in handbags. Spade set out to design<br />

the perfect purse and in 1993 she launched her<br />

own line of handbags. The line debuted with<br />

just six silhouettes with which she combined<br />

sleek, utilitarian shapes and colourful palettes<br />

in an entirely new way that was also stylish.<br />
